Consisting of vocalist/lyricist/visionary [[Dean Ballinger|Wolfgang Ach]], [[Rob Talsma|Slor Amslat]] on lead guitar, [[Justin Harris|Lars (Lars) Larsen]] on lead guitar (sometimes referred to as Laas Von Trapp for copyright reasons), [[Aaron Watkinson|Rufus Niechmeier]] on lead bass and [[Greg Page|Lager Oonst]] on lead drums, the band played consistently throughout the year whipping audiences into frenzied mashing with their catch cry “We vill rock you till Venesday" and songs such as [[Let there be Malestrum]], [[Blue metal]], [[Rock your arse off baby]] and the political [[Smash the state]].

The band headed back to Sweden in 1999, but during a stopover in the Pacific Islands, most members lost their tickets and some remain there till this day. Unfortunately, there remain no recordings of their work, but some video does exist, which may be released at some time. ''Ach'' is now heavily involved in the "wordless poetry" movement, ''Niechmeier'' runs a small cocktail bar in the islands, ''Amslat'' has released a number of "teach yourself lead metal rock lead guitar" DVDs, ''Larsen'' is now a Linguistics professor and is presently writing a Swedish heavy metal dictionary and ''Oonst'' is the drummer in a heavy metal band in Hamilton.
